4-Methoxybenzyl mercuric chloride

Base Information Edit
  • Chemical Name:4-Methoxybenzyl mercuric chloride
  • CAS No.:34820-80-9
  • Molecular Formula:C8H9ClHgO
  • Molecular Weight:357.202
  • Hs Code.:
  • DSSTox Substance ID:DTXSID50188362
  • Wikidata:Q83060169
  • Mol file:34820-80-9.mol
4-Methoxybenzyl mercuric chloride

Synonyms:4-Methoxybenzyl mercuric chloride;34820-80-9;p-anisylmercury chloride;DTXSID50188362

synthetic route:
Guidance literature:
In tetrahydrofuran; byproducts: LiCl; Ar atm.;; the mixt. was poured into ice mixed with conc. HCl, ppt. was filtered, washed with water, recrystd. from acetone;;
DOI:10.1016/S0022-328X(00)82466-3
Guidance literature:
With methanol; In methanol; byproducts: Hg2Cl2, 4-CH3OC6H4CH3, HCl; vacuum-sealed ampule, abs. methanol, 65°C for 100h; autocatalytic react. (catalyst: HCl which is formed during the react.), investigation of effect of HgCl2, NaCl and (C2H5)4NBF4 on react.-rate; separation of Hg, analysis of decanted soln. by TLC and GLC; Kinetics;
DOI:10.1007/BF00956358
